Output 63e14823dae5a09c244944545ad88e2fe598cecb7947eb307b9ef4c81ccfd42e:0

value
2559644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bd8cae7425070e59170a77af2c58fbcf6ed376 OP_EQUAL
address
3PYeVXLnXypuVJNtLCpcVyyWazwzRG8c5A
transaction
63e14823dae5a09c244944545ad88e2fe598cecb7947eb307b9ef4c81ccfd42e
confirmations
166321
spent
true